    Q: How do I install Germaly Font on my computer?

    To install Germaly Font, simply extract the downloaded zip file to your computer and follow the installation instructions for your operating system. For Windows, drag the font files to the Windows Fonts folder. For macOS, copy the font files to the Library/Fonts folder. For Linux, copy the font files to the /usr/share/fonts or ~/.fonts folder.
